Vehicle Speed Sensor Locations


https://images.2carpros.com/forum/automotive_pictures/12900_s_28.jpg

REMOVAL 1.Apply the parking brake. 2.Raise the vehicle and support it with suitable safety stands. 3.Remove harness connector. 4.Remove screw. 5.Remove speed sensor. *Have a suitable container to catch fluid. 6.Remove O-ring seal. *Inspect all parts for wear or damage INSTALLATION 1.Install new O-ring seal. *Coat the seal with a thin film of transmission fluid. 2.Install Speed Sensor. *Rotate the cover into place. 3.Install screw. *Torque to 11 Nm (8 lbs ft). 4.Install harness connector. *Lower the vehicle. *Release the parking brake. 5.Add transmission fluid if needed. https://www.2carpros.com/kpages/auto_repair_manuals_alldata.htm
